Product Overview
The 1x2 low-reflection-loss fiber optic splitter is a high-performance passive optical device designed for high-stability optical signal distribution and multiplexing.
Key Features
- 1x2 optical signal distribution architecture
- Insertion loss ≤ 0.2 dB
- Return loss ≥ 50 dB
- Wide operating wavelength range of 1260nm - 1650nm
- Compatible with single-mode and multimode fiber
- Up to 1000 mating cycles
- ISO9001 and CE certified
Applications
- Fiber optic communication systems
- Fiber optic sensor networks
- Local area network (LAN) node distribution
- Fiber optic test and measurement equipment
- Monitoring systems for physical quantities such as temperature, pressure, and strain

1. What is the operating temperature range of this splitter? Can it withstand extreme outdoor or industrial sensing environments?
The product uses a high-purity quartz glass substrate , supporting a wide industrial-grade operating and storage range of -40°C to +85°C. Whether in harsh outdoor fiber optic junction boxes (OCCs) or high-temperature, high-pressure industrial sensing nodes, it maintains excellent optical stability and long-term reliability.2
